Turpentine

Turpentine is composed of terpenes, primarily the monoterpenes alpha- and beta-pinene, with lesser amounts of carene, camphene, limonene, and terpinolene.

[14] As a solvent, turpentine is used for thinning oil-based paints, for producing varnishes, and as a raw material for the chemical industry.

Its use as a solvent in industrialized nations has largely been replaced by the much cheaper turpentine substitutes obtained from petroleum such as white spirit.

Commercially used camphor, linalool, alpha-terpineol, and geraniol are all usually produced from alpha-pinene and beta-pinene, which are two of the chief chemical components of turpentine.
